Why this album works

The album debuted at number 3 on the Oricon charts, marking a significant achievement for Do As Infinity and affirming their popularity in Japan. It received positive reviews for its lyrical depth and sonic variety, further solidifying the duo's influence within the J-pop genre. The single 'I can't be myself' was particularly noted for its emotional resonance and radio play, becoming a staple of their live performances.

Context
True Song is Do As Infinity's fifth studio album, released during a peak period in their career following the commercial success of their earlier albums. By this time, they had solidified their place in the J-pop scene, demonstrating a mature sound while continuing to explore new musical directions. This album came two years after their previous release, Deep Forest, showcasing their evolution as artists.
